Esta postagem fornecerá um procedimento para redefinir a senha do usuário do Oracle após o vencimento.
Como redefinir a senha do usuário do Oracle após o vencimento?
Para redefinir a senha do usuário do Oracle após o vencimento, faça o login no banco de dados como “Sysdba”Ao digitar o seguinte comando:
Sqlplus sys/root1234 como sysdbaNo comando acima, “ROOT1234"É a senha do"Sys" do utilizador.
Saída
A saída mostra que o usuário foi conectado.
Desbloquear a conta de usuário
O "Alterar o usuário”Cláusula com“Desbloqueio da conta”Pode ser utilizado para desbloquear a conta do usuário após o login como um“Sysdba”:
Alterar o usuário C ## Dani conta desbloquear;Na declaração acima, “C ## Dani”É o nome de usuário.
Saída
A saída mostra que o usuário foi alterado.
Redefina a senha do usuário
A senha do usuário do banco de dados Oracle pode ser alterada usando o “ALTERAR”Comando. O exemplo é dado abaixo:
Alterar o usuário C ## Dani identificado por Dani321;No exemplo acima, “Dani321”É a nova senha usada com“IDENTIFICADO POR”.
Saída
A saída "Usuário alterado”Mostrou que a senha do usuário foi alterada.
Aplicação da expiração de senha
Use o "Senha expire”Cláusula com a“ALTERAR”Comando para forçar o usuário a alterar sua senha após o próximo login. O comando a fazer isso é dado abaixo:
Alterar o usuário C ## Dani senha expire;Saída
A saída mostra que o usuário foi alterado.
Vamos confirmar se a senha do usuário foi alterada ou não fazendo login na conta do usuário. O comando para fazer login no “C ## Dani”O usuário é fornecido abaixo:
SQLPlus C ## Dani/Dani321Saída
A saída demonstra que, ao fazer login, a senha definida por "sysdba" expirou e o usuário foi solicitado a especificar um novo.
Como alternativa, a instrução a seguir pode ser usada para alterar a senha do usuário após a expiração, desbloquear a conta do usuário e forçar o usuário a alterar a senha após o próximo login em uma única instrução:
ALTER Usuário C ## Dani Identificado por Dani1234 Desbloquear a senha de desbloqueio;Na declaração acima, “Dani1234”É a nova senha do usuário.
Saída
A saída mostrou que as alterações especificadas foram feitas com sucesso.
Conclusão
Para redefinir a senha do usuário do Oracle após o vencimento, faça o login no banco de dados como um “Sysdba”. Em seguida, use o “ALTERAR"Declaração com"Desbloqueio da conta”Para desbloquear a conta de usuário. O "IDENTIFICADO POR”A cláusula pode ser usada para redefinir a senha do usuário. Use o "Senha expire”Para forçar o usuário a alterar a senha após o próximo login. Este guia explicou como redefinir a senha do usuário do Oracle após o vencimento.